DigitalRev Already Has Canon EOS 70D Section (though no pics or specs)

Online retailer DigitalRev already has a Canon EOS 70D section in their menu (see pic above). The link is active and leads to an empty page (see pic below). The main specs of the EOS 70D have leaked a few days ago. The announcement of the Canon EOS 70D is expected for July 2nd. The specs are:

  • 20.2mp CMOS Sensor
  • DIGIC 5+
  • 19pt AF System (All Cross Type)
  • 7fps
  • Built-in WiFi
  • 3″ Vari-Angle Touch Screen LCD
  • ISO 12,800 Maximum
  • Dual Pixel CMOS Autofocus
  • Full HD Video
  • HDR
  • Multiexposure Mode
  • LP-E6 Battery

Canon EOS 70D Dual Pixel Auto-Focus Specs Leaked

Digicame-info posted some information about the new Dual Pixel auto-focus featured on the upcoming EOS 70D. The text is machine translated, so use your interpretation skills:

  • Is used as a phase difference detection element is divided into two each photodiode sensor on Dual Pixel CMOS AF.
  • Possible to focus only on the image plane phase difference AF.
  • It is one pixel in the sum of both for the two split normally. Phase difference detection is possible over the entire surface on the hardware because it is the same structure as full, but the periphery truncate the frame-like reliability of the information because the fall large influence of aberrations of the lens.
  • Are not used for the time being in Kiss series computational load is large, because of the high cost still.
  • I do not extend to the phase difference AF traditional, but it supposed to be a farewell to the live view slow in terms of speed.
  • There is also a mode similar to the hybrid CMOS AF used in combination with contrast AF lens for the old.

Canon PowerShot SX280 HS Review (DigitalCamera Review, low noise levels)

 PowerShot SX280 Review
DigitalCamera Review reviewed the GPS and WiFi-enabled Canon PowerShot SX280 HS, an excellent travel camera, with a price tag of $265/€299. The SX280 core specs:
  • 12.1MP High-Sensitivity CMOS Sensor
  • DIGIC 6 Image Processor
  • 20x Optical Zoom Lens
  • 35mm Focal Length Equivalent: 25-500mm
  • 3.0″ LCD Monitor
  • Full HD 1080p Video Capture at 60fps
  • Built-in Wi-Fi Connectivity
  • Intelligent Optical Image Stabilization
  • Hybrid Auto Mode
  • GPS Tracker

DigitalCamera Review liked the 20x zoom of the PowerShot SX 280 HS, and the excellent low noise levels (due to Canon’s conservative approach concerning sensor resolution). In the conclusion DigitalCamera Review writes:

The SX280 HS is a compact, well designed, sturdy, and easy to use point and shoot digital camera with a 20x zoom. Compared to its competition, the biggest difference would seem to be in the resolution arena with Canon sticking with a reasonable 12-megapixels.
